The Holidays can be very hard for some, but for parents of Parental Alienation it is a mater of loneliness, depression and confusion. "What am I supposed to do? What do my kids expect? Do they think about me? How should I be feeling and dealing with the absence of my kids?" are just some of the questions you may ask. I know what that is like because it has been 6 years since I celebrated a Christmas with my kids and over 2 years since I have seen or talked to them. I miss them so deeply and words cannot explain.

Each year I send my kids things to remind them how much they mean to me and that they are precious in every way.

I was given the opportunity to share something on the radio with you for Christmas, but thought what better than to present you with but a new story from “The Adventures of Cal-Boy Kitty and Noey Joey.”

Many may wonder what that is. Well when I went to put my kids to bed I would make up stories with them as the main characters that go through life adventures and conquer issues that may be challenging. Many times I would fall asleep while telling the story as they would be riveted enough to wonder what was next. With each story, every night, I would sign off with them saying, “I love you. Care for you. And pray for you.” But my daughter would have me give her an Eskimo Kiss after each line. As she would rub her nose next to mine she would start to giggle and at the end say “nothing” standing for nothing more and I trust your love.
